body{margin:0;font-family:-apple-system,BlinkMacSystemFont,"Segoe UI","Roboto","Oxygen","Ubuntu","Cantarell","Fira Sans","Droid Sans","Helvetica Neue",s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}code{font-family:source-code-pro,Menlo,Monaco,Consolas,"Courier New",monospace}:root{--ucp-blue:#3b3b3f;--ucp-blue-dark:#1f1f23;--ucp-green:#8fe912;--footer-bg:#292c2f;--footer-icon-bg:#33383b;--card-bg:hsla(0,0%,100%,0.92);--text-dark:#12324f}*,:after,:before{box-sizing:border-box}#root,body,html{margin:0;padding:0;min-height:100%;font-family:"Segoe UI",Roboto,Arial,sans-serif}body{background:#f2f5f9}.app-shell{min-height:100vh;display:flex;flex-direction:column}.bg-li,.top-nav{background:linear-gradient(90deg,var(--ucp-blue-dark),var(--ucp-blue));border-bottom:1px solid hsla(0,0%,100%,.14);z-index:1000;padding:18px 0;box-shadow:0 10px 28px rgba(0,0,0,.28)}.navbar-brand,.top-nav .container{align-items:center}.navbar-brand{display:flex;padding-top:0;padding-bottom:0;margin-right:18px}.logoucp{width:200px;height:auto;display:block;transition:transform .25s ease}.logoucp:hover{transform:scale(1.03)}.navbar-light .navbar-toggler{border-color:hsla(0,0%,100%,.45);padding:.35rem .55rem}.navbar-light .navbar-toggler:focus{box-shadow:0 0 0 .16rem hsla(0,0%,100%,.22)}.navbar-light .navbar-toggler-icon{background-image:url(/static/media/menuHam.d32fe843.png)!important;background-size:contain}#basic-navbar-nav{width:100%}.nav-links{display:flex;flex-wrap:wrap;align-items:center;grid-gap:18px;gap:18px}.nav-links a{color:#fff;text-decoration:none;font-weight:700;margin-right:0;white-space:nowrap;transition:color .2s ease,transform .2s ease}.nav-links a:hover{color:var(--ucp-green);transform:translateY(-1px)}.institutional-bg{background:radial-gradient(circle at 18% 20%,rgba(0,98,156,.95) 0,rgba(0,98,156,.5) 28%,transparent 52%),radial-gradient(circle at 82% 24%,rgba(98,151,105,.55) 0,rgba(98,151,105,.25) 26%,transparent 50%),linear-gradient(135deg,#004c86,#0b6d92 45%,#629769);padding:42px 26px 34px!important}.bg-grainient{position:absolute;inset:0;z-index:0;overflow:hidden;background:radial-gradient(circle at 12% 18%,hsla(0,0%,100%,.1) 0,transparent 24%),radial-gradient(circle at 88% 10%,rgba(143,233,18,.1) 0,transparent 28%),radial-gradient(circle at 72% 82%,rgba(34,167,242,.14) 0,transparent 30%),linear-gradient(135deg,#004c86,#0b6d92 45%,#629769)}.bg-layer,.bg-layer-1,.bg-layer-2,.bg-layer-3{transform:none!important}.bg-grainient:after,.bg-layer,.bg-layer-1,.bg-layer-2,.bg-layer-3{display:none!important;animation:none!important}.dashboard-grid{position:relative;z-index:2;display:grid;grid-template-columns:repeat(3,minmax(220px,1fr));grid-gap:14px;gap:14px;width:min(1200px,100%);margin:0 auto}.panel-card{background:var(--card-bg);border:1px solid hsla(0,0%,100%,.55);border-radius:14px;padding:16px 18px;box-shadow:0 10px 28px rgba(12,28,44,.24);-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px)}.panel-card h3{margin:0 0 10px;color:var(--text-dark);font-size:1.02rem;font-weight:800}.big-number{margin:2px 0 6px;font-size:3rem;line-height:1.05;font-weight:800;color:#0f2842}.muted{margin:0;color:#31495e;font-weight:600}.muted.strong{font-weight:700}.clock-card .time-box{display:block;background:transparent;padding:0;min-width:0}.clock-card .time-title{margin:0 0 10px;color:var(--text-dark);font-size:1.02rem;font-weight:800}.weather-row{display:flex;grid-gap:14px;gap:14px;align-items:center}.weather-left{flex:0 0 auto}.weather-right{flex:1 1}.weather-icon{font-size:2rem;color:#1f4f82}.service-list{list-style:none;margin:0;padding:0}.service-list li{display:flex;justify-content:space-between;align-items:center;grid-gap:10px;gap:10px;border-top:1px solid #e7edf5;padding:8px 0}.service-list li:first-child{border-top:none}.service-list li span{flex:1 1}.ok{color:#16a34a}.down,.ok{font-weight:800}.down{color:#dc2626}.checking{color:#d97706;font-weight:800}.updated-box{display:inline-block;margin-top:10px;background:#e6e8eb;padding:8px 14px;border-radius:0 0 12px 12px;color:#45627d;font-size:.95rem;font-weight:500}.footer{border-top:4px solid #fff}.footer-distributed{background-color:var(--footer-bg);width:100%;padding:22px 34px;display:grid;grid-template-columns:1.1fr 1.2fr 1fr;grid-gap:16px;gap:16px;color:#fff}.logo-footer{width:200px;max-width:100%;margin-bottom:10px}.footer-company-name{color:#b9c1cb;font-size:14px;margin:0}.footer-center>div{display:flex;align-items:center;grid-gap:10px;gap:10px;margin-bottom:8px}.footer-center i{background-color:var(--footer-icon-bg);color:#fff;width:34px;height:34px;border-radius:50%;display:grid;place-items:center}.footer-center p{margin:0}.footer-center p a{color:#fff;text-decoration:none}.footer-company-about{color:#c3cad3;font-size:13px;margin:0 0 8px}.footer-company-about span{display:block;color:#fff;font-size:14px;font-weight:700;margin-bottom:10px}.footer-icons{display:flex;grid-gap:8px;gap:8px}.footer-icons a{width:34px;height:34px;background-color:var(--footer-icon-bg);border-radius:6px;color:#fff;text-decoration:none;display:grid;place-items:center;transition:transform .2s ease,background-color .2s ease}.footer-icons a:hover{transform:translateY(-1px);background-color:#4a5058}@media (max-width:991px){.institutional-bg{padding:14px}.dashboard-grid{grid-template-columns:1fr}.navbar-brand{margin-right:10px}.logoucp{width:140px}#basic-navbar-nav{margin-top:12px}.nav-links{display:flex;flex-direction:column;align-items:flex-start;grid-gap:10px;gap:10px;padding-top:6px;width:100%}.nav-links a{display:block;width:100%}.footer-distributed{grid-template-columns:1fr;text-align:center}.footer-center>div,.footer-icons{justify-content:center}}@media (max-width:576px){.bg-li,.top-nav{padding-top:6px;padding-bottom:6px}.navbar-brand{margin-right:8px}.logoucp{width:200px}.big-number{font-size:2.2rem}.panel-card{padding:14px 15px}.footer-distributed{padding:18px 16px}}.feriados-section{padding-top:4px}.feriados-section+.feriados-section{border-top:1px solid rgba(15,35,55,.1);padding-top:14px}.clock-card .feriados-section:first-of-type{margin-bottom:14px}.clock-card .feriados-section+.feriados-section{margin-top:14px!important;padding:10px 12px;border-top:1px solid rgba(15,35,55,.08);background:hsla(0,0%,100%,.18);border-radius:12px}.clock-card .feriados-section+.feriados-section>p{margin-bottom:8px!important;font-size:12px;font-weight:700;letter-spacing:.02em;color:#5b7185;text-transform:uppercase}.clock-card .feriados-section+.feriados-section .service-list{margin:0!important}.clock-card .feriados-section+.feriados-section .service-list li{display:flex;align-items:center;justify-content:space-between;grid-gap:12px;gap:12px;padding:7px 0;border-bottom:1px solid rgba(15,35,55,.05)}.clock-card .feriados-section+.feriados-section .service-list li:last-child{border-bottom:0;padding-bottom:0}.clock-card .feriados-section+.feriados-section .service-list li span{display:block;flex:1 1;font-size:14px;line-height:1.25;color:#4e6275}.clock-card .feriados-section+.feriados-section .service-list li small{display:none!important}.clock-card .feriados-section+.feriados-section .service-list li strong{flex-shrink:0;font-size:12px;font-weight:700;color:#c56a00;background:rgba(213,118,0,.08);padding:4px 8px;border-radius:999px;min-width:auto}.clock-card .feriados-section+.feriados-section .service-list li:nth-child(n+3){display:none}.clock-card .feriados-section+.feriados-section{opacity:.95}.clock-card .feriados-section:first-of-type>p{font-size:14px;font-weight:700;color:#28445d}:root{--anim-ease:cubic-bezier(0.22,1,0.36,1);--ucp-accent-blue:#22a7f2;--ucp-accent-green:#8fe912}@media (prefers-reduced-motion:reduce){*,:after,:before{animation:none!important;transition:none!important;scroll-behavior:auto!important}}.bg-li,.top-nav{position:-webkit-sticky;position:sticky;top:0;overflow:hidden;animation:navReveal .75s var(--anim-ease) both}.bg-li:after,.top-nav:after{content:"";position:absolute;left:0;bottom:0;width:100%;height:3px;background:linear-gradient(90deg,#004c86,#22a7f2,#8fe912,#004c86);background-size:240% 100%;animation:navLineMove 8s linear infinite}@keyframes navReveal{0%{opacity:0;transform:translateY(-22px);filter:blur(8px)}to{opacity:1;transform:translateY(0);filter:blur(0)}}@keyframes navLineMove{0%{background-position:0 50%}to{background-position:240% 50%}}.logoucp{filter:drop-shadow(0 8px 18px rgba(0,0,0,.35))}.logoucp:hover{transform:scale(1.045)}.nav-links a{position:relative;padding:8px 2px}.nav-links a:after{content:"";position:absolute;left:0;bottom:1px;width:100%;height:2px;border-radius:999px;background:linear-gradient(90deg,var(--ucp-accent-blue),var(--ucp-accent-green));transform:scaleX(0);transform-origin:left;transition:transform .28s var(--anim-ease)}.nav-links a:hover:after{transform:scaleX(1)}.bg-layer{inset:-10%;filter:blur(60px);opacity:.9;mix-blend-mode:screen;will-change:transform}.bg-grainient:after,.bg-layer{position:absolute;pointer-events:none}.bg-grainient:after{content:"";inset:0;background:linear-gradient(120deg,hsla(0,0%,100%,.08),transparent 30%,hsla(0,0%,100%,.05) 60%,transparent);opacity:.75;animation:softLightMove 12s ease-in-out infinite alternate}@keyframes softLightMove{0%{transform:translateX(-3%) translateY(-2%)}to{transform:translateX(3%) translateY(2%)}}.dashboard-grid .panel-card{opacity:0;transform:translateY(34px) scale(.985);filter:blur(8px);animation:cardReveal .8s var(--anim-ease) forwards;will-change:transform,opacity,filter}.dashboard-grid .panel-card:first-child{animation-delay:.12s}.dashboard-grid .panel-card:nth-child(2){animation-delay:.24s}.dashboard-grid .panel-card:nth-child(3){animation-delay:.36s}.dashboard-grid .panel-card:nth-child(4){animation-delay:.48s}@keyframes cardReveal{to{opacity:1;transform:translateY(0) scale(1);filter:blur(0)}}.panel-card{position:relative;overflow:hidden;border-radius:18px;background:linear-gradient(180deg,hsla(0,0%,100%,.96),rgba(245,250,252,.92));box-shadow:0 18px 40px rgba(4,20,35,.2),inset 0 1px 0 hsla(0,0%,100%,.65);transition:transform .28s var(--anim-ease),box-shadow .28s var(--anim-ease),border-color .28s var(--anim-ease)}.panel-card:before{content:"";position:absolute;inset:0;background:radial-gradient(circle at top left,rgba(34,167,242,.14),transparent 36%),radial-gradient(circle at bottom right,rgba(143,233,18,.1),transparent 32%);opacity:0;transition:opacity .28s ease;pointer-events:none}.panel-card:hover{transform:translateY(-7px);box-shadow:0 24px 56px rgba(4,20,35,.28),inset 0 1px 0 hsla(0,0%,100%,.8);border-color:rgba(34,167,242,.42)}.panel-card:after{content:"";position:absolute;left:18px;right:18px;top:0;height:3px;border-radius:0 0 999px 999px;opacity:.85}.big-number{letter-spacing:-.04em;text-shadow:0 8px 22px rgba(15,40,66,.12)}.clock-card .big-number{font-feature-settings:"tnum";font-variant-numeric:tabular-nums}.weather-left i,.weather-left img{animation:weatherFloat 3.2s ease-in-out infinite alternate}@keyframes weatherFloat{0%{transform:translateY(0) rotate(-2deg)}to{transform:translateY(-5px) rotate(2deg)}}.service-list li{transition:background-color .22s ease,transform .22s ease,padding-left .22s ease;border-radius:10px}.service-list li:hover{background-color:rgba(34,167,242,.06);transform:translateX(3px);padding-left:8px;padding-right:8px}.checking,.down,.ok{display:inline-flex;align-items:center;grid-gap:6px;gap:6px;padding:3px 9px;border-radius:999px;font-size:.82rem;line-height:1.2}.ok{color:#0f8f3c;background:rgba(22,163,74,.1)}.ok:before{content:"";width:7px;height:7px;border-radius:50%;background:#16a34a;box-shadow:0 0 0 rgba(22,163,74,.45);animation:okPulse 1.8s ease-out infinite}.down{color:#b91c1c;background:rgba(220,38,38,.1)}.checking{color:#b45f00;background:rgba(217,119,6,.1)}@keyframes okPulse{0%{box-shadow:0 0 0 0 rgba(22,163,74,.45)}70%{box-shadow:0 0 0 7px rgba(22,163,74,0)}to{box-shadow:0 0 0 0 rgba(22,163,74,0)}}.clock-card .feriados-section:first-of-type .service-list li{padding:10px 0}.clock-card .feriados-section:first-of-type .service-list li strong{color:#d97706;background:rgba(217,119,6,.09);padding:5px 10px;border-radius:999px}.footer-icons a{position:relative;overflow:hidden}.footer-icons a:before{content:"";position:absolute;inset:0;background:linear-gradient(135deg,var(--ucp-accent-blue),var(--ucp-accent-green));opacity:0;transition:opacity .25s ease}.footer-icons a i{position:relative;z-index:1}.footer-icons a:hover{transform:translateY(-3px)}.footer-icons a:hover:before{opacity:1}.panel-card .shine,.panel-card>*{position:relative;z-index:1}.panel-card{isolation:isolate}.panel-card:hover{cursor:default}.panel-card:hover:before{opacity:1}.panel-card .card-shine{display:none}.panel-card::selection{background:rgba(34,167,242,.22)}.panel-card:hover:after{opacity:1}.panel-card{--shine-x:-120%}.panel-card:after,.panel-card:before{z-index:0}.panel-card:hover{background:linear-gradient(180deg,hsla(0,0%,100%,.98),rgba(245,250,252,.94))}.panel-card:hover .big-number{transform:translateY(-1px)}.big-number{transition:transform .25s var(--anim-ease),color .25s ease}.services-card .service-list li span small{margin-top:4px;color:#60768a}.services-card .service-list li strong.checking{min-width:86px;justify-content:center;color:#0f4f7a;background:rgba(34,167,242,.11)}.updated-box{border-radius:999px;background:rgba(15,40,66,.08);color:#28445d;font-weight:800}.dashboard-grid{grid-gap:20px;gap:20px}.panel-card{padding:22px 24px}::-webkit-scrollbar{width:10px}.footer-icons a:focus-visible,.nav-links a:focus-visible,.service-list li:focus-visible{outline:3px solid rgba(143,233,18,.45);outline-offset:3px}
/*# sourceMappingURL=main.88e7d6f3.chunk.css.map */